#84979a - Nichols Beach color

A cool, muted slate with subtle blue-green undertones, this color reads as a sophisticated, weathered teal-gray. It evokes calm coastal mist, aged metal, and quiet sophistication. Soft yet grounded, it works well as a neutral backdrop or accent in interiors, bringing a serene, modern vibe. Pairs beautifully with warm woods, creamy whites, deep navy, or brass accents. Ideal for calming bedrooms, bathrooms, or elegant living spaces where an understated, contemporary atmosphere is desired.
